Storyline

Inside the idyllic community of Smallville, the intertwined destinies of Clark Kent, Lana Lang, and Lex Luthor begin to take shape while an imminent danger emerges: a high-school prank has spawned a vengeful villain who has acquired super powers of his own. (This standalone version of the series pilot combines footage with the second episode, newly formatted in 1.78 widescreen, and has an alternate closing produced for the Canadian DVD market.)
